Office of the Chief Financial Officer

The Office of the Chief Financial Officer (OCFO) provides fiscal policy guidance as well as accounting, budget, financial, and grants management.

OCFO consists of four divisions:

  • Budget Formulation, Liaison, Planning, and Performance Division
  • Budget Execution Division
  • Finance, Accounting, and Analysis Division
  • Grants Financial Management Division

These divisions work together to assess grantee and OJP financial management policies, procedures, and practices, and to contribute to overall financial integrity and the achievement of OJP-wide goals and objectives. Services include:

  • OJP annual budget preparation and liaison on Congressional appropriations matters
  • Programmatic performance measurement, reporting, and analysis
  • Allocation, tracking, and reporting of OJP funds
  • Implementation of the Federal Managers' Financial Integrity Act, Government Performance and Results Act, and other statutes and initiatives
  • Financial reporting and analysis
  • Grant financial closeout
  • Grantee customer service on financial matters
  • Grantee financial monitoring, site visits, and compliance review
  • Technical - financial assistance to grantees and program offices
  • Financial management training to grantees and program offices
  • Financial management policy development and implementation
